What Is a Cash Advance?

A cash advance is a short-term loan designed to help cover immediate financial needs until your next paycheck or scheduled income deposit.

These loans are commonly used for:

  • Emergency expenses
  • Unexpected bills
  • Car repairs
  • Medical or dental costs
  • Rent or utility payments
  • Temporary cash flow shortages

Cash advances are intended for short-term financial situations and should be borrowed responsibly.

Basic Requirements for a Cash Advance in Nevada

Most lenders require applicants to provide basic information to help verify identity and income. Common requirements may include:

  • Valid government-issued identification
  • Proof of income
  • Active checking account
  • Current contact information
  • Proof of Nevada residency
  • Minimum age requirement

Requirements can vary depending on the lender, loan type, and individual financial situation.

Why Proof of Income Matters

One of the most important parts of the application process is verifying that you have a regular source of income.

Income may come from:

  • Employment wages
  • Self-employment income
  • Retirement benefits
  • Disability payments
  • Other qualifying income sources

Lenders review income to help determine whether a borrower can reasonably repay the loan according to the agreed terms.

Having consistent income may improve your chances of qualifying, even if your credit history is limited or less than perfect.

Do You Need Good Credit to Apply?

Not always. Some cash advance lenders focus more on your current financial situation and ability to repay than on your credit score alone.

While credit history may still be considered, many lenders also review:

  • Income stability
  • Account activity
  • Employment status
  • Overall financial situation

This may allow some borrowers with poor or limited credit histories to still apply for short-term loan options.

Responsible Borrowing Is Important

Cash advances are intended for short-term use and should not replace long-term financial planning.

Before accepting a loan, borrowers should:

  • Review repayment terms carefully
  • Borrow only what is necessary
  • Understand all fees and obligations
  • Ask questions if anything is unclear

Responsible lending and transparency are important parts of the borrowing process. Understanding the terms before signing paperwork can help borrowers make informed financial decisions.
